John Gilmore was an actor in the '50's, and knew John Hodiak (LIFEBOAT). Hodiak lived in the same apartment complex as Monroe in 1953, and Hodiak introduced Gilmore to Marilyn. Gilmore continued to be acquainted with Marilyn from that to time until they were up for a 20th Century Fox movie in '60, but Marilyn was fired from the studio and the movie (THE STRIPPER) was revamped by Fox, excluding both Marilyn and Gilmore.

The movie was called Bus Stop, released in 1956 and stared Marilyn Monroe as Cherie and Don Murray as Beauregard "Bo" Decker.
